Stray bullet hits boy’s head in Pudukottai
The Hindu
CISF personnel were undergoing training
An 11-year-old boy from Narthamalai in Pudukottai was grievously injured after being hit on the head by a stray bullet from the nearby firing range where personnel of Central Industrial Security Force were reportedly undergoing training.
The boy was rushed to the Pudukottai Government Medical College Hospital and later referred to the Thanjavur Medical College Hospital
According to police sources, a practice session was under way for trainees at the shooting range when a stray bullet from one of the rifles hit the boy, K. Pughazhendhi, near his place of residence, located some distance away from the range. The boy was staying in his grandfather’s house.
